The Hexadecimal Color #CD6305 is a contrast shade of Chocolate. #CD6305 RGB value is rgb(205, 99, 5). RGB Color Model of #CD6305 consists of 80% red, 38% green and 1% blue. HSL color Mode of #CD6305 has 28°(degrees) Hue, 95% Saturation and 41% Lightness. #CD6305 color has an wavelength of 602.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CD6305 is #FF6633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CD6305 is #C60. The Closest Color to #CD6305 is #D2691E. Official Name of #CD6305 Hex Code is Indochine.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CD6305 is 0 Cyan 52 Magenta 98 Yellow 20 Black and #CD6305 CMY is 0, 52, 98. Various Color Shades of #CD6305

To get 25% Saturated #CD6305 Color, you need to convert the hex color #CD6305 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#CD6305 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CD6305

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
